Most people do Sonamarg as a day trip. The 87km drive from Srinagar -- 2 to 2.5 hours each way -- is manageable in a single day, and the majority of visitors who come to the Thajiwas glacier meadow and the Sonamarg valley are gone by 3pm. The day-trip version of Sonamarg is a good thing. It is not the same thing as staying.

What the overnight stay gives you is the hour between 5:30 and 7am: the Sonamarg valley before the day-trip vehicles arrive from Srinagar, before the Thajiwas pony handlers have assembled at the taxi stand, before the market tea stalls have fully opened. That hour -- the meadow in early light, the mist still sitting in the gorge above the glacier, the Gujjar herd animals moving along the valley floor -- is the quality of Sonamarg that the day-trip version cannot reach. A J&K Tourism 2024 visitor survey found that fewer than 12% of Sonamarg's approximately 380,000 summer visitors stayed overnight. The experience available to that 12% is substantively different from the experience available to the 88%.

What Sonamarg Hotels Are Actually Like

Sonamarg is not a hotel destination in the way that Pahalgam or Gulmarg is. There is no heritage property, no converted old Kashmiri haveli, no business hotel with a gym. What Sonamarg has is a cluster of small family-run guesthouses, a handful of mid-range resort properties, and a few large budget dormitory camps that serve the Amarnath Yatra pilgrimage traffic and the summer backpacker route.

The town itself is a single main market road -- about 400m long -- with guesthouses and small hotels positioned along it and on the short lanes running perpendicular toward the meadow. The meadow side is east-facing: morning light, views across the valley floor to the ridgeline above the Sindh, and the upper Sonamarg meadow visible from the better rooms. The highway side faces northwest toward the Srinagar road and the service structures of the market.

The facility level reflects the altitude and the seasonality. Sonamarg hotels are open from May through October; most close entirely for the winter. Hot water is from solar panels or gas geysers -- confirm this when booking. Room heating in June is not an issue; temperatures at 2,740m drop to 8 to 12 degrees at night in June and July, which is cool but manageable with the blankets provided. Air conditioning is not a feature of any Sonamarg hotel and is not needed.

Sonamarg Hotels vs Day Trip: Which Makes Sense for Your Trip?

The honest answer: if you have 4 or fewer days in Kashmir and the itinerary already includes Pahalgam and Gulmarg, the Sonamarg day trip is the right call. If you have 6 or more days and Sonamarg is a specific reason you came -- the glacier, the alpine meadow, the quiet -- then one night here justifies the logistics. Types of Sonamarg Accommodation in 2026

Meadow-Edge Guesthouses (Rs 1,500 to 3,500)

Small family-run properties on the lanes between the market road and the meadow. Some have rooms with direct meadow views; others have the meadow visible from a shared veranda or dining room. These are the most common and most reliable category for visitors who want to be in Sonamarg for the experience rather than the facilities. Hot water is usually geyser-based; confirm when booking. Breakfast is typically included: Kashmiri bread, omelette, chai or kahwa.

Mid-Range Resort Properties (Rs 3,500 to 6,500)

Three or four resort-style properties operate in Sonamarg with 20 to 40 rooms, attached bathrooms, room service, and some landscaping. These offer more consistent facilities -- the hot water system is more reliable, the rooms are better maintained, and the restaurant on-site means you are not dependent on market dhabas for dinner. The view quality from the better rooms in this category is genuinely good. Via Kashmir's verified list includes the mid-range properties that have been assessed directly.

Amarnath Yatra Camps (Rs 800 to 1,500) -- Not Recommended for General Visitors

Large tent or basic dormitory camps that operate during the July-August Yatra season for pilgrims doing the Baltal route. The facilities are Yatra-scale and the camp environment is busy and functional rather than restful. This category is mentioned here because it shows up in general Sonamarg accommodation searches and the price point looks attractive without context.

What You Get From Staying the Night

The morning: the Thajiwas glacier meadow before 8am is a different place from the Thajiwas glacier meadow at 10am. The light on the ice from the east, the wildflowers in the meadow before the pony traffic has churned the lower section, the quiet of the gorge before the tourist season's daily cycle gets going. If you are in the meadow by 6:30am from a Sonamarg guesthouse, you have at least 90 minutes before the first day-trip visitors walk up from the taxi stand.

The evening: Sonamarg in the late afternoon, after the day-trippers have departed by 3 to 4pm, returns to something close to what the valley actually is. The Gujjar herders move the animals back through the main meadow. The market dhabas do a quiet dinner trade. The light from the west hits the eastern ridgeline from 5pm onward and stays on the upper slopes until past 7pm in late June. This is the quality that an 87km return drive to Srinagar cuts out entirely.

How much do Sonamarg hotels cost in 2026?

Budget guesthouses in Sonamarg run Rs 1,500 to 2,500 per night for a double room with breakfast. Mid-range resort properties run Rs 3,000 to 6,500. Prices rise 20 to 30% during peak weekends in late June and throughout July. Most Sonamarg hotels include breakfast; dinner is typically available on-site or at market dhabas 2 to 5 minutes' walk away.

When do Sonamarg hotels open and close?

Most Sonamarg hotels open in early May when the Srinagar-Leh highway clears of winter snow and close in late October after the Amarnath Yatra season ends. The peak season is June through August. In November, only a handful of properties remain open and some days road access can be limited. December through April, the highway is closed or restricted by snow and virtually all Sonamarg hotels are shut.
